Equality Hits Iowa – Same Sex Marriage Upheld in State

Iowa’s state Supreme Court upheld a lower court’s ruling in favor of same sex marriage on Friday, April 3, 2009. This makes Iowa the first state in the Mid-West to move towards equality in the marriage realm.
